Overview

Ontario is a small city in Ohio with a population of 6,648 people. It ranks as the 227th largest community in the state.

The city has a moderate income level with a per capita income of $32,389 in 2022, equating to about $129,556 annually for a family of four.

Commute

Most residents drive alone with moderate commute times.

Ontario's commute patterns reflect typical suburban driving habits with many residents driving alone and moderate commute durations.

Car-Dependent — High rate of driving alone to work.
Moderate Commute Times — Most commutes are between 15 and 30 minutes.
Drive Alone Rate85.6%
Carpool Rate11.3%
Main Commute Time15-30 minutes
